Overview
The MSc Medical Imaging is designed for qualified radiographers who wish to progress into enhanced and advanced clinical practice through specialist education in modern imaging technologies.
Programme Overview
Students develop expertise in advanced imaging, clinical decision-making, leadership, digital health, and research. They may complete the general MSc or specialise in Computed Tomography (CT), Magnetic Resonance Imaging (MRI), Artificial Intelligence (AI), or Ultrasound pathways. The programme combines academic learning with clinical practice and strong NHS partnerships.
Eligibility Criteria
A recognised degree in Radiography or a related healthcare discipline (depending on pathway).
IELTS 6.5 overall (minimum 6.0 in each band) or equivalent.
Meet Glasgow Caledonian University's postgraduate admission requirements; some pathways require professional registration and/or relevant clinical experience.
